Unfortunately, all the free e-mail providers he has tried are no longer allowed. If we take these providers off the "unrestricted" list on the forum, we are opening ourselves up to the spam problem we had previously.

Ask your friend if he has an internet provider e-mail. Usually internet services will give you one of their own e-mail addresses specific to the service. You can explain to him that Gmail, Yahoo, Hotmail, etc. do not have any mitigation for non-human users. Someone could create an endless amount of e-mail addresses with any of these providers, and that makes it easy for spammers to continuously hammer on a site.

See if he has access to a provider e-mail, and that should help him register without problems. I hope this helps! If not, let me know.
